if you decide to get the valve adjustment, makesure the place leaves your car there either over 4 hrs before he does the adjustment or the valve adjustment will be off even more... (car HAS to be cool) its only 90$-100$ at local shops, or if you have a feelers gauge it can be done in your yard in about 2hrs or so for a beginner, just know how to get your vehicle to TDC and the right order and you are set... any helms/haynes/chiltons manual gives perfect step by step instructions...
It's most likely the valves. Compression is lost and performance and mpg will suffer, other than that it's pretty much just annoying.
Do you run 0w-20 or 5w-20 oil? If so use 5w-30 and see if it goes away. If it doesn't then adjust your valves.
If you never did valves before and don't know anyone who has a clue, I recommend taking it to a shop because setting the pistons in the right position for each intake and exhaust valve can be tricky for rookies.
